Data Analyst Engineer I - Onsite Role in Norco, CA

Job Summary:

The Data Analyst Engineer I will provide critical support to Navy operations by developing, maintaining, and enhancing data visualization, reporting, and collaboration platforms. This entry-level role focuses on leveraging tools such as Power BI, Splunk, Tableau, and SharePoint to deliver actionable insights, automate reporting processes, and streamline workflows across teams. The ideal candidate will be a self-motivated individual with strong analytical skills, capable of transforming raw data into clear, value-added reports that improve decision-making and operational effectiveness. This position requires the ability to work in a fast-paced environment and proactively solve problems while supporting mission-critical Navy requirements.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op, design, and maintain interactive dashboards and reports in Power BI, Tableau, and Splunk to support leadership decision-making

  • Build and manage SharePoint sites to enhance collaboration, document sharing, and workflow efficiency

  • Perform advanced data analysis, including cleaning, structuring, and interpreting large datasets to identify trends and provide actionable recommendations

  • Automate recurring reporting processes and data pipelines to improve accuracy and reduce manual effort

  • Collaborate with stakeholders to understand requirements and deliver tailored data-driven solutions

  • Integrate data from multiple sources, ensuring consistency, accuracy, and security in reports and dashboards

  • Provide ongoing monitoring, troubleshooting, and improvement of existing dashboards and platforms

  • Recommend and implement workflow improvements, applying independent judgment to enhance performance and system stability

  • Document reporting logic, processes, and system configurations for transparency and repeatability

  • Support Navy compliance and security requirements when handling and presenting sensitive data

Basic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Data Analytics,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, or a related field

  • 0-2 years of experience in data analytics, business intelligence, or a related technical role

  • Proficiency with Power BI, Tableau, Splunk, and SharePoint

  • Strong SQL and database query skills, with the ability to handle large datasets

  • Demonstrated ability to automate data workflows and reporting pipelines

  • Excellent problem-solving skills with strong attention to detail

  • Effective written and verbal communication skills for both technical and non-technical audiences

  • Must be a U.S Citizen

  • Must be able to obtain and maintain Secret level clearance

  • If applicable: If you are or have been recently employed by the U.S. government, a post-employment ethics letter will be required if employment with VSolvit is offered

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Master's degree in Data Analytics, Information Systems, or related technical discipline

  • 2-4 years of professional experience in data analytics, preferably within defense or government environments

  • Familiarity with Navy systems, compliance standards, and data security practices

  • Knowledge of scripting languages (Python, R, or similar) for advanced data processing and automation

  • Prior experience in workflow analysis and systems improvement to enhance stability and performance

  • Active DoD Secret clearance

Founded in 2006, VSolvit (pronounced 'We Solve It') is a technology services provider that specializes in cybersecurity, cloud computing, geographic information systems (GIS), business intelligence (BI) systems, data warehousing, engineering services, and custom database and application development.
